Vega, I respect and enjoy reading your posts about basketball and will add a little bit more about why I said that statement above. Fitz is our closest thing to a PF but he lacks a post up game, especially when playing people of equal size to him. He is more of a pick and pop, step away from the basket type forward. When he posts up down low and goes at the rim he gets rejected on a regular basis. Rudd is a 3 man, He may be 230lbs but he is not a power forward. He has no leverage, this why when he attacks the rim off the dribble he gets bodied away and his inability to post up against a 4 man. Both players seem to have gotten tired of having to defend much bigger guys on the defensive end, guys they wouldn't have to guard as much if the academic people would have let our recruit in.
